What diseases and disabilities are linked to chromosome 17? I need a full list please.?


Can someone please make a list of all the diseases, disabilities and conditions linked to chromosome 17?
----------

Genetics Home Reference includes these conditions related to genes on chromosome 17:

Alexander disease
Amish lethal microcephaly
Andersen-Tawil syndrome
Birt-Hogg-Dubé syndrome
bladder cancer
breast cancer
campomelic dysplasia
Canavan disease
Charcot-Marie-Tooth disease
cystinosis
Ehlers-Danlos syndrome
epidermolysis bullosa simplex
familial atrial fibrillation
galactosemia
hereditary folate malabsorption
hereditary neuropathy with liability to pressure palsies
hyperkalemic periodic paralysis
hypokalemic periodic paralysis
Job syndrome
Li-Fraumeni syndrome
N-acetylglutamate synthase deficiency
neurofibromatosis type 1
nonsyndromic deafness
osteogenesis imperfecta
pachyonychia congenita
paramyotonia congenita
Pompe disease
potassium-aggravated myotonia
pyridoxal 5'-phosphate-dependent epilepsy
short QT syndrome
Smith-Magenis syndrome
tetra-amelia syndrome
Usher syndrome
very long-chain acyl-coenzyme A dehydrogenase deficiency
Chromosome Trisomy 17 p 11.2- Down's Syndrome
Autism

GeneCards provides a table of genes on chromosome 17 and disorders related to those genes.  (+ info)

What other diseases can be acquired by getting addicted to alcohol?


Harry, my lab partner, is an alcoholic. He doesn't want to admit it but he is an alcoholic. Alcohol is like his daily vitamins or something. He drinks whenever he can... even before going to class! I'm really worried about him and I want to help him overcome his alcoholism. I'm also scared that he might develop other diseases just because of his bad drinking habits. I can't get through a day in chem without him. Please help me.
----------

Are you in love with you lab partner? I'm just kidding. Anyway, there are certain diseases which may be developed because of alcoholism. Some of these are Wernicke's Encephalopathy, Korsakoff's syndrome, cirrhosis, fetal alcohol syndrome (for babies with drinking mothers), liver diseases and even cancer. Alcoholics have difficulties in coordination, reflexes, concentration, judgment and sleeping. Other effects of alcoholism include distorted vision, memory lapses and blackouts.  (+ info)

What causes the emergence and reemergence of infectious diseases?


What causes the emergence and reemergence of infectious diseases?

-Thank you sooo much!
----------

Many things cause the emergence/reemergence of infectious diseases: antimicrobial resistance, increasing global travel, globalization of the food supply, ecological and climate changes, people and wild animals living in closer proximity and human behavior to name a few.  (+ info)

What are diseases caused by shortage or excessive of lipids?


I just want to know the names of the diseases.
----------

Deficiency of essential fatty acids
A major deficiency may cause damage to the heart, as well as the kidneys and liver. Behavior disturbances may also result from a deficiency in the diet.

Hair loss and skin eczema have also been reported as well as excessive sweating.

An under-par immune system may result from a shortage of this nutrient which in turn may result in slow healing wounds, and susceptibility to infections etc.

Stiffness in joints may happen, and an under secretion of tear and saliva may be indicative of too little essential fatty acids in the diet.

It has also been suggested that it may have an influence on infertility in men and miscarriages in women.

Blood pressure may be elevated and the formation of blood clots may be an increased risk to contend with.

Toxicity and symptoms of high intake
No toxicity has been reported in healthy individuals but people with health problems should be careful with taking any supplements.

People suffering from epilepsy should be careful of taking supplements of seed oils, as they can aggravate the problem, while people with blood disorders or a problem with bleeding should be careful of fish oil supplements.

Should you be taking a supplement of essential fatty acids, it would be recommended that you first discuss it with your health professional.

What are the major causes of heart diseases?


I know "heart disease" is like a term used to describe ALL kinds of diseases having to do with the heart and arteries...so I was wondering if there were any causes to these diseases that are common in most of them. Thanks for any help!
----------

There are many factors that increase one's risk for heart disease. The biggest three are smoking, obesity and blood pressure. Also take into account age, comorbidties (other diseases that can affect the heart, like diabetes) heredity, and diet.  (+ info)
